      • I don't like the double primary[i] at all[/i]. There was something nice about having primary, secondary, heavy slots. I knew, when switching weapons, what to expect. My primary was going to be one of a few weapon types. My secondary was going to be one of a few weapon types. My heavy was one of a select few types. Now when I'm switching, I have no idea what my load out is going to look like. Sure. I should know what weapon type I assigned to what position. But there's something so much nicer about going auto rifle to sniper, than there is about going auto rifle to auto rifle. In this new set up, the weapons handle so similarly that I, as a player, can't tell which one is kinetic and which has an element assigned to it. I found myself button mashing through my weapons just to see what was different and nothing felt like anything special. I wasn't a fan of this change. I'd like to see the old weapons system return.

              Efficiency in Destiny PvE boils load outs down to snipers and high power (mostly exotic) heavies. Shotguns and fusions are used situationally and often switched for a snipers when killing bosses. I can respect people for using shotguns for add control but there are often better options. I don't have much issue with D2's scheme. Most of my add control kills involve a primary in Destiny with a special being reserved for bosses after my heavy is spent. I see D2 loadouts as two engagement ranges where I have ample ammunition to transition seamlessly from mere add control to lieutenant duty to boss DPS. I mean a shotgun shell currently in D1 is roughly 10-15% of your special inventory that comes out to about 12-19 shots for that exotic hunter HC ( I honestly hope it's only hunter exclusive for the beta)
